Catalyst‐Directed Selectivity in Vinylcarbene Reactions: A Comparative Study of Ag, Rh, and Cu Complexes

open access: yesAdvanced Synthesis &Catalysis, EarlyView.
This study reveals that ligand stereoelectronic effects, rather than vinylogous electrophilicity, govern selectivity in Ag‐, Rh‐, and Cu‐catalyzed vinylcarbene C(sp3)H insertions. These insights guide the design of more selective catalysts for CH functionalization.

Metal-Dependent Umpolung Reactivity of Carbenes Derived from Cyclopropenes

open access: yesiScience, 2019
Summary: Metal carbenes, divalent carbon species, are versatile intermediates that enable novel synthetic pathways. These species exhibit either electrophilic or nucleophilic character, depending on the carbene and metal fragments.

Three‐Component Synthesis of γ‐Amino Esters with α‐Quaternary Carbon Centers via NHC/Photoredox Dual Catalysis

open access: yesAdvanced Synthesis &Catalysis, EarlyView.
γ‐Amino acid derivatives with an α‐quaternary center are prevalent in medicinally important compounds. A dual N‐heterocyclic carbene/photocatalytic pathway is developed for the three‐component synthesis of α, α ‐disubstituted γ‐amino esters. This methodology allows for the rapid synthesis of diverse libraries of γ‐amino esters in good yields.
